Proline rich nuclear receptor coactivator 2 pseudogene 1 (PNRC2P1) is a non-protein-coding pseudogene derived from the functional PNRC2 gene. Pseudogenes such as PNRC2P1 are characterized by DNA sequence homology to their parent gene, but they are unable to be translated into functional proteins due to disabling mutations or lack of regulatory elements[1][3]. Most pseudogenes are biological "junk DNA," though occasionally, transcripts from pseudogenes can play regulatory roles. No specific biological function, disease association, or therapeutic relevance has been described for PNRC2P1[1][3]. This entity should not be considered a conventional drug target or functional molecule.
